Trilithic releases new compact LC bandpass filters

Trilithic Inc. a market leader in RF and microwave components has released a new series of compact LC bandpass filters for the Iridium telephony band. This pole placed bandpass filter passes the 1616.0 to 1626.5 MHz band with a maximum insertion loss of 2.6 dB while providing a minimum of 15 dB of isolation at GPS L1 and 70 dB minimum at GPS L2.
